What Prop Firms Actually Want from Traders
Prop firm challenges are designed to identify traders who can survive under pressure—not those who can gamble their way to a target. This distinction is critical.
Prop firms measure:
-
Risk consistency
-
Emotional stability
-
Rule compliance
A professional forex prop firm strategy focuses on staying within limits every single day. Profit targets are secondary; survival is primary.
Why Most Traders Fail Funded Evaluations
The majority of traders fail because they approach evaluations like a competition. They try to reach targets quickly, increase position sizes, and trade low-quality setups.
Professional traders understand that:
-
Time is not the enemy
-
Drawdown is the real risk
-
One mistake can end the account
Passing evaluations requires patience and restraint—traits most retail traders have not yet developed.
Designing a Professional Forex Day Trade Approach
Most funded traders rely on a structured forex day trade model. Day trading allows tighter risk control, no overnight exposure, and faster performance feedback.
A professional day trading framework includes:
-
One or two highly liquid currency pairs
-
Fixed trading sessions (London or New York)
-
Predefined stop-loss and take-profit logic
Simplicity is an edge. Fewer decisions reduce emotional interference and improve execution quality.
Best Days to Trade Forex in Prop Firm Accounts
Timing your activity correctly can significantly improve your results. The best days to trade forex are typically Tuesday, Wednesday, and Thursday.
These days offer:
-
Strong institutional participation
-
Cleaner price action
-
More reliable volatility
Monday often lacks direction, while Friday introduces profit-taking and unpredictable moves. Professionals adjust exposure accordingly rather than forcing trades.
Risk Management: The Core of Every Forex Prop Firm Strategy
Risk management is the foundation of funded trading success. Even profitable strategies fail if risk is mismanaged.
Professional standards typically include:
-
0.25%–1% risk per trade
-
Daily loss limits well below firm maximums
-
Fixed position sizing
This conservative approach ensures that losing streaks remain manageable and accounts stay alive.
Trading Psychology Under Funded Conditions
Trading someone else’s capital introduces unique psychological pressure. Fear of breaching rules can lead to hesitation, while early success can lead to overconfidence.
Experienced traders manage this by:
-
Treating evaluations as performance audits
-
Focusing on execution, not outcomes
-
Following written trading plans without exception
Once emotions are neutralized, consistency becomes achievable.
Scaling After Getting Funded
Passing the challenge is only the first milestone. Long-term success depends on maintaining the same discipline on live funded accounts.
Professional traders scale by:
-
Increasing capital allocations gradually
-
Managing multiple funded accounts
-
Keeping risk percentages constant
This method allows income growth without increasing drawdown exposure or emotional stress.
